Experience

Legal Roles

PPrior to joining McIntyre Szabo PC, Zoë (she/her) gained experience in civil and administrative litigation, including commercial litigation, Aboriginal law, employment law, prison law, municipal law and immigration law.  

Practice Areas

Zoë represents and advises clients in the health care sector, including healthcare institutions, regulated health practitioners and other regulated professionals. She is building a broad-based health litigation practice at McIntyre Szabo PC including professional regulation, mental health hearings and appeals, physician privileging, human rights applications and inquests.

Health Industry

Zoë comes from a family of healthcare professionals spanning multiple generations. While in law school, she worked as a research assistant, conducting health law research on assisted reproductive technologies, with a particular focus on egg freezing and in vitro fertilization (IVF).
